Since, I am constantly hungry, I put together a list of my favorite go to snacks. 🙂
- Peanut butter and jelly (to make it more healthy, you can get the no sugar added jelly)– Thank God I’m not allergic to nuts, because I LOVE peanut butter and it’s staying power!
- Nuts– A handful of almonds or any type of nut can really satiate you. Almonds and cashews are my faves.
- Fruit, yogurt and granola parfaits– I love Stonyfield yogurt (especially the new Greek ones) because it’s organic AND tasty! I also found a family owned granola company that I love– Ladera. I will layer yogurt, strawberries, blueberries and granola for a healthy parfait.
- Larabars— These bars have always been one of my favorite snacks–they have no artificial sugars, flavors, dyes, etc. and usually have no more than 7 ingredients, all of which you can read! 😉
- Watermelon– Watermelon is great for hydrating you (which you need for nursing) and for satisfying a sweet craving. I swear I could eat half a watermelon myself!
